⭐ The Stress Relief Benefits of Massage Therapy
One of the most immediate benefits of massage therapy is stress relief. In today’s fast paced world, stress builds quietly and consistently. We carry it in our shoulders, our lower back, our jaw, and even in our breathing patterns. Over time, this tension affects sleep, mood, productivity, and overall health.
During my first session, I felt muscles release that I did not even realize were tight. Massage therapy helps lower cortisol, the body’s primary stress hormone, while increasing serotonin and dopamine, the chemicals responsible for relaxation and emotional balance. Techniques such as Swedish massage, deep tissue work, and trigger point therapy target areas where stress hides, helping the body shift from fight or flight into a calmer, more grounded state.
The result is a clearer mind, deeper breathing, and a sense of calm that stays with you long after the session ends. This experience made me realize that stress management is not optional. It is essential for long term wellness.
⭐ Restoring Balanced Wellness Through Massage
Beyond stress relief, massage therapy supports overall wellness in ways that are often overlooked. One of the biggest advantages is improved circulation. When blood flow increases, oxygen and nutrients reach muscles more efficiently, helping the body recover faster and function better.
After a few sessions, I noticed:
- higher energy levels
- less stiffness in my neck and shoulders
- better posture
- reduced fatigue
- improved flexibility
Massage also supports lymphatic drainage, which helps the body remove toxins and reduce inflammation. This becomes especially important as we age, when mobility naturally decreases and recovery takes longer.
Another surprising benefit was the emotional clarity that followed each session. The mind body connection becomes incredibly clear when tension is released. Physical relief often leads to emotional relief, creating a sense of balance that is difficult to achieve through other wellness practices alone.
⭐ The Long Term Benefits of Consistent Massage Therapy
One of the most overlooked benefits of massage therapy is how much it supports long term health when practiced consistently. Many people think of massage as a one time fix for pain or stress, but the real transformation happens when it becomes part of a routine.
Regular sessions help maintain muscle health, prevent tension from building up, and support better posture, something most of us struggle with due to long hours sitting or working at a desk.
I also noticed that consistent massage improved my sleep quality. When your muscles are relaxed and your nervous system is calmer, falling asleep becomes easier and your body stays in a deeper, more restorative sleep cycle. Over time, this leads to better energy, improved mood, and a stronger immune system.
These long term benefits make massage therapy a powerful investment in your overall wellness, not just a temporary escape.
